/**
 * A TxHashSet is a transactional hash set data structure that provides atomic operations
 * on unique values within Effect transactions. It uses an immutable HashSet internally
 * with TxRef for transactional semantics, ensuring all operations are performed atomically.
 *
 * ## Mutation vs Return Behavior
 *
 * **Mutation operations** (add, remove, clear) modify the original TxHashSet and return `Effect<void>` or `Effect<boolean>`:
 * - These operations mutate the TxHashSet in place
 * - They do not create new TxHashSet instances
 * - Examples: `add`, `remove`, `clear`
 *
 * **Transform operations** (union, intersection, difference, map, filter) create new TxHashSet instances:
 * - These operations return `Effect<TxHashSet<T>>` with a new instance
 * - The original TxHashSet remains unchanged
 * - Examples: `union`, `intersection`, `difference`, `map`, `filter`
 *
 * @example
 * ```ts
 * import { Effect, TxHashSet } from "effect"
 *
 * const program = Effect.gen(function*() {
 *   // Create a transactional hash set
 *   const txSet = yield* TxHashSet.make("apple", "banana", "cherry")
 *
 *   // Single operations are automatically transactional
 *   yield* TxHashSet.add(txSet, "grape")
 *   const hasApple = yield* TxHashSet.has(txSet, "apple")
 *   console.log(hasApple) // true
 *
 *   // Multi-step atomic operations
 *   yield* Effect.tx(
 *     Effect.gen(function*() {
 *       const hasCherry = yield* TxHashSet.has(txSet, "cherry")
 *       if (hasCherry) {
 *         yield* TxHashSet.remove(txSet, "cherry")
 *         yield* TxHashSet.add(txSet, "orange")
 *       }
 *     })
 *   )
 *
 *   const size = yield* TxHashSet.size(txSet)
 *   console.log(size) // 4
 * })
 * ```
 *
 * @since 2.0.0
 * @category models
 */
export interface TxHashSet<in out V> extends Inspectable, Pipeable {
  readonly [TypeId]: typeof TypeId
  readonly ref: TxRef.TxRef<HashSet.HashSet<V>>
}

/**
 * Creates an empty TxHashSet.
 *
 * @example
 * ```ts
 * import { Effect, TxHashSet } from "effect"
 *
 * const program = Effect.gen(function*() {
 *   const txSet = yield* TxHashSet.empty<string>()
 *
 *   console.log(yield* TxHashSet.size(txSet)) // 0
 *   console.log(yield* TxHashSet.isEmpty(txSet)) // true
 *
 *   // Add some values
 *   yield* TxHashSet.add(txSet, "hello")
 *   yield* TxHashSet.add(txSet, "world")
 *   console.log(yield* TxHashSet.size(txSet)) // 2
 * })
 * ```
 *
 * @since 2.0.0
 * @category constructors
 */
export const empty = <V = never>(): Effect.Effect<TxHashSet<V>> =>
  Effect.gen(function*() {
    const ref = yield* TxRef.make(HashSet.empty<V>())
    return makeTxHashSet(ref)
  })

/**
 * Creates a TxHashSet from a variable number of values.
 *
 * @example
 * ```ts
 * import { Effect, TxHashSet } from "effect"
 *
 * const program = Effect.gen(function*() {
 *   const fruits = yield* TxHashSet.make("apple", "banana", "cherry")
 *   console.log(yield* TxHashSet.size(fruits)) // 3
 *
 *   const numbers = yield* TxHashSet.make(1, 2, 3, 2, 1) // Duplicates ignored
 *   console.log(yield* TxHashSet.size(numbers)) // 3
 *
 *   const mixed = yield* TxHashSet.make("hello", 42, true)
 *   console.log(yield* TxHashSet.size(mixed)) // 3
 * })
 * ```
 *
 * @since 2.0.0
 * @category constructors
 */
export const make = <Values extends ReadonlyArray<any>>(
  ...values: Values
): Effect.Effect<TxHashSet<Values[number]>> =>
  Effect.gen(function*() {
    const hashSet = HashSet.make(...values)
    const ref = yield* TxRef.make(hashSet)
    return makeTxHashSet(ref)
  })

/**
 * Creates a TxHashSet from an iterable collection of values.
 *
 * @example
 * ```ts
 * import { Effect, TxHashSet } from "effect"
 *
 * const program = Effect.gen(function*() {
 *   const fromArray = yield* TxHashSet.fromIterable(["a", "b", "c", "b", "a"])
 *   console.log(yield* TxHashSet.size(fromArray)) // 3
 *
 *   const fromSet = yield* TxHashSet.fromIterable(new Set([1, 2, 3]))
 *   console.log(yield* TxHashSet.size(fromSet)) // 3
 *
 *   const fromString = yield* TxHashSet.fromIterable("hello")
 *   const values = yield* TxHashSet.toHashSet(fromString)
 *   console.log(Array.from(values)) // ["h", "e", "l", "o"]
 * })
 * ```
 *
 * @since 2.0.0
 * @category constructors
 */
export const fromIterable = <V>(values: Iterable<V>): Effect.Effect<TxHashSet<V>> =>
  Effect.gen(function*() {
    const hashSet = HashSet.fromIterable(values)
    const ref = yield* TxRef.make(hashSet)
    return makeTxHashSet(ref)
  })

/**
 * Creates a TxHashSet from an existing HashSet.
 *
 * @example
 * ```ts
 * import { Effect, TxHashSet } from "effect"
 * import * as HashSet from "effect/HashSet"
 *
 * const program = Effect.gen(function*() {
 *   const hashSet = HashSet.make("x", "y", "z")
 *   const txSet = yield* TxHashSet.fromHashSet(hashSet)
 *
 *   console.log(yield* TxHashSet.size(txSet)) // 3
 *   console.log(yield* TxHashSet.has(txSet, "y")) // true
 *
 *   // Original hashSet is unchanged when txSet is modified
 *   yield* TxHashSet.add(txSet, "w")
 *   console.log(HashSet.size(hashSet)) // 3 (original unchanged)
 *   console.log(yield* TxHashSet.size(txSet)) // 4
 * })
 * ```
 *
 * @since 2.0.0
 * @category constructors
 */
export const fromHashSet = <V>(hashSet: HashSet.HashSet<V>): Effect.Effect<TxHashSet<V>> =>
  Effect.gen(function*() {
    const ref = yield* TxRef.make(hashSet)
    return makeTxHashSet(ref)
  })

/**
 * Checks if a value is a TxHashSet.
 *
 * @example
 * ```ts
 * import { Effect, TxHashSet } from "effect"
 * import * as HashSet from "effect/HashSet"
 *
 * const program = Effect.gen(function*() {
 *   const txSet = yield* TxHashSet.make(1, 2, 3)
 *   const hashSet = HashSet.make(1, 2, 3)
 *   const array = [1, 2, 3]
 *
 *   console.log(TxHashSet.isTxHashSet(txSet)) // true
 *   console.log(TxHashSet.isTxHashSet(hashSet)) // false
 *   console.log(TxHashSet.isTxHashSet(array)) // false
 *   console.log(TxHashSet.isTxHashSet(null)) // false
 * })
 * ```
 *
 * @since 2.0.0
 * @category guards
 */
export const isTxHashSet = (u: unknown): u is TxHashSet<unknown> => hasProperty(u, TypeId)
